Chimney cap rep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the protective cover that sits atop a chimney. This cover, known as a chimney cap, is designed to prevent debris, animals, and water from entering the chimney flue. Repair services may involve fixing or replacing damaged or rusted parts, resealing loose components, or addressing issues caused by wear and tear over time. Proper repair ensures the chimney cap continues to function effectively, helping to safeguard the chimney structure and improve overall safety.
Addressing common problems such as rust, corrosion, or physical damage is a primary goal of chimney cap repair.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ause the cap to deteriorate, creating gaps or holes that compromise its protective function. This can lead to water leaks, which may cause damage to the chimney lining or interior walls, or allow animals and debris to enter the chimney. Repair services aim to resolve these issues promptly, preventing further damage and maintaining the integrity of the chimney system.

Basic Chimney Cap Repair - Typical costs for repairing or replacing a chimney cap range from $150 to $400, depending on the material and size. For example, a standard metal cap may cost around $200, while custom options could be higher.
Material Costs - The price varies based on the material used, with aluminum caps generally costing between $100 and $250. Copper or stainless steel caps tend to be more expensive, often ranging from $300 to $600.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for chimney cap repairs typically fall between $100 and $300 per job. The complexity of the repair and local labor rates influence the final cost in Edison and nearby areas.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if structural repairs are needed or if the chimney requires additional work to ensure proper sealing. These extra services can add $50 to $200 to the overall exp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
